Gard highlights

  • Uzès

    The small town of Uzès is one of France’s most authentically preserved towns despite its popularity amongst the Parisian gentry.
  • Pont du Gard

    This aqueduct is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of the world’s most beautifully preserved examples of ancient Roman architecture.
  • Anduze

    This picturesque medieval village is nestled in the hills marking the entrance to the Cevennes Mountain Range.
  • Nîmes

    Nîmes boasts a rich architectural history, brimming with ancient Roman monuments, prestigious townhouses and religious edifices.
  • Le Grau-du-Roi

    Le Grau-du-Roi, the only commune in the Gard department to border the sea, offers 12 miles of France’s most remote beaches.
  • The medieval town of Aigues Mortes

    The fortified town of Aigues Mortes is one of France’s best preserved examples of 13th century military architecture.
  • Villeneuve-Lès-Avignon

    The picturesque town of Villeneuve-Lès-Avignon, founded in the 13th century, boasts the Fortress of Saint-André: a French National Heritage Site.
  • Aiguèze

    Aiguèze, listed in the Most Beautiful Villages in France, is perched high on a cliff overlooking the Ardèche River.

    We liked the very harmonious mix of ancient history and modern attractions. The map provided by the tourist office with 40 interesting points of interest marked for you to wander in your own time very useful. We had drinks in many places but ate in La Vigourie and IX Louis only. Both delicious and great value. Even though one of us has a few mobility problems walking around in short bursts worked fine; the town is small enough. Sunday market was excellent for end of season summer dresses, roast chickens and figs! Walking the ramparts (in flat shoes) is probably a must, educational animations along the way are well done with sub-titles. A week is a good stay length, take a short train ride to the sea-side ports, architectural surprises like La Grande Motte and out into the Camargue flats.

    The Arena of Nîmes is a Roman amphitheatre built around 100...

    The Arena of Nîmes is a Roman amphitheatre built around 100 AD, shortly after the Colosseum of Rome, it is one of the best-preserved Roman amphitheatres in the world. The Jardins de la Fontaine are one of the first public parks in Europe and, even today, one of the most remarkable. The Museum of Romanity in Nîmes is a museum located opposite the Roman amphitheatre of Nîmes, In the heart of the Nîmoise city, faced with the two-millennial arenas, this archaeological museum presents the collections of the city. Nimes, the Rome of France.
